The uppermost stratum of our globe undergoes the direct action of
the light and heat of the all-vivifying "orb of day." This action,
very unequal in its effects, and most important to understand, has
scarcely been touched as yet by scientific research. Our geologists,
having been more busily engaged with the inside than the outside
of the earth, have broached certain plausible theories--for the
most part of a very dubious character--respecting the central fire,
Plutonism and Neptunism, the stratification of the planets, the
formation of mountains, valleys, and basins. Our mineralogists,
thinking far less of the chemical molecular constitution of the
different formations than of their crystalline constitution, have
minutely studied the physical qualities and geometrical forms of the
integral parts of the rocks; but neither have condescended to direct
their inquiries to the layer of soil trodden underneath their feet.
Yet this very layer of arable earth, to which all bodies must return
after death what they have taken from it during life,--this much
despised _humus_, furnishes all our agricultural products, the very
foundation and support of our material existence.

ON THE CHEMICAL ACTION OF LIGHT.
It is no easy study to investigate the modifications and chemical
effects which the terrestrial surface is capable of receiving or
undergoing, either from the direct rays of the sun, or from diffused
light. It requires new methods of inquiry,--methods frequently
of extreme delicacy, as the labours of Bunsen and Roscoe, of
Kirchhofer and Tyndall, have abundantly demonstrated. Let us here
confine ourselves to establishing the fact that the chemical action
of light varies according to the geological constitution of the
soil,--according to the diurnal and annual obliquity of the solar
rays,--according to the hours of the day,--according to the latitudes
and seasons. The maximum of effects is manifested about the times of
the solstices.
For the better co-ordination of these phenomena, might we not, as has
been done in regard to the distribution of heat over the terrestrial
surface,[78] link together by lines the points of equality? We should
thus create an aggregate of _iso-photo-chemical_ lines,--diurnal,
mensual, and annual,--of incontestible utility for the progress of
general physics and meteorology, which are still in their infancy.
But to realise this magnificent programme, the union and agreement is
necessary of scientific men in every region of the globe; an ideal,
therefore, as yet, is very far from being attained.
